New Delhi, August 9: What is wrong with the top most leaders of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P)? Why are they making regular sexist remarks and blatantly displaying their patriarchal mindset, post the horrific stalking and attempt to kidnap episode in Chandigarh?

Chandigarh woman Varnika Kundu who while driving her car back home on the intervening night of Friday and Saturday was followed for seven-eight kilometers by two men, Vikas Barala and Ashish Kumar. The accused also stopped Varnika's car in an attempt to allegedly abduct her.

babul supriyo

Vikas is the son of Haryana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) chief, Suresh Barala. It's a high profile case, as the son of a VIP belonging to the ruling party, both in the state and at the Centre, is one of the main accused.

Supriyo, as we have already said, is not alone in indulging in victim-shaming. Haryana BJP vice president Ramveer Bhatti blamed the victim for the "shocking" incident as she was out on the road late in the night.

"Why was she allowed to roam around at night? Parents should not allow their children to stay out late...what is the point of roaming around at night?" questioned Bhatti.

One more high-profile BJP leader, Shaina NC, in spite of being a woman herself decided to blame Varnika--for coming out in the open and report about the injustice done to her-- by indicating that the 29-year-old DJ and daughter of an Indian Administrative Service (IAS) officer has some sinister motive to accuse the son of a VIP.

Shaina tweeted, "So called victim Beti with Vikas Barala'' and that the now famous Chandigarh stalking case of Varnika Kundu, who accused Haryana BJP chief Subhash Barala's son Vikas Barala of stalking her at midnight in the streets of Chandigarh is only as true as the news about Jasleen Kaur and Rohtak Sisters." The tweet was lifted from a Supreme Court lawyer's tweet.

After she was criticised for her tweet, Shaina deleted it. Then the BJP spokesperson claimed that her Twitter account was hacked and requested all to ignore the tweets from her handle.
